,可以使用编程语言提供的日期时间处理库或函数来实现。具体的实现方式会根据所使用的编程语言而有所不同。以下是一种常见的实现方式:
在JavaScript中,可以使用Date对象的构造函数来将字符串转换为date对象。示例代码如下:
var dateString = "2022-01-01";
var dateObject = new Date(dateString);
在Python中,可以使用datetime模块来将字符串转换为date对象。示例代码如下:
import datetime
date_string = "2022-01-01"
date_object = datetime.datetime.strptime(date_string, "%Y-%m-%d").date()
在Java中,可以使用SimpleDateFormat类来将字符串转换为date对象。示例代码如下:
import java.text.DateFormat;
import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.Date;
String dateString = "2022-01-01";
Date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d");
Date dateObject;
try {
dateObject = dateFormat.parse(dateString);
} catch (ParseException e) {
e.printStackTrace();
}
这些示例代码中,我们将字符串"2022-01-01"转换为对应的date对象,并将其赋值给dateObject变量。你可以根据具体的需求和编程语言选择适合的方法来实现字符串到date对象的转换。
关于字符串转换为date对象的应用场景,常见的场景包括从用户输入中获取日期、日期的比较和计算、日期的格式化和展示等。在实际开发中,我们经常需要处理日期相关的数据,将字符串转换为date对象是一个常见的操作。
腾讯云提供了多种云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。这些产品可以帮助开发者快速搭建和部署云计算环境,提供稳定可靠的基础设施支持。你可以访问腾讯云官网了解更多关于这些产品的详细信息和使用方法。
参考链接:
领取专属 10元无门槛券
手把手带您无忧上云